Answer:
Father's age is 50, Son's age is 10
Step-by-step explanation:
X+Y=60
X-Y= 40
Let X represent the Father's age while Y represents the Son's age;
therefore, from the two equations, the value of X is
X= 60-Y
X= 40+Y then putting in the value of x
(40+Y) + Y= 60,
40+2Y=60
2Y=60-40 =20
Y= 10,
Now that we know the value of Y, we can get the value of x
If X+Y=60, then
X+10=60,
X=60-10,
X= 50

Y = x² - 8x + 29
y = (x² -8x +4²) + 29 -4² . . . . add and subtract the square of half the x-coefficient
y = (x -4)² + 13 . . . . . . . . . . . . simplify
The appropriate choice is
C. y = (x - 4)² + 13
